Unmasking the Culprit: The Role of Forensic Toxicology
Forensic toxicology plays a critical role in criminal investigations by analyzing biological samples to pinpoint the presence of drugs, poisons, or other toxic substances. These analyses can provide invaluable insights that help investigators solve complex cases and obtain justice for victims. By examining blood, urine, tissue samples, and even hair, forensic toxicologists can determine the presence of substances and their potential role in a crime, whether it be homicide, drug dealing, or occurrence.
Their findings often corroborate witness accounts, shed light on hidden facts, and ultimately help hold accountable the perpetrators of crimes. The detailed nature of forensic toxicology ensures that results are accurate, providing a solid foundation for legal proceedings and contributing to a fair and just verdict.

Unmasking CSI: Science and Showbiz
While intriguing,"true-crime" shows like CSI often take creative liberties for dramatic effect, there's a kernel of authenticity at their core. The series have undoubtedly popularized forensic techniques and their role in investigations. Nevertheless, viewers should understand that the speed and precision of forensic analysis depicted on television are often stretched. In actual cases, complex procedures can take days, weeks, or even months to complete.
For example, DNA testing, a staple of CSI episodes, requires careful collection and processing of evidence, followed by rigorous laboratory analysis. While the process is becoming increasingly efficient, it's not as instantaneous as often portrayed on screen.
- The reliability of forensic evidence can be affected by a variety of factors, including errors during collection and analysis.
- Moreover, the faith on technology alone can sometimes lead to misleading conclusions if not properly interpreted.
Despite these challenges, CSI has certainly contributed in raising public knowledge about forensic science. It's important to remember that the show is primarily entertainment and should be viewed as such, while appreciating the fascinating world of forensic investigations.

From Bytes to Beings: The Power of Electronic Forensics
In the ever-evolving landscape of progress, where our lives are increasingly intertwined with the digital realm, the need for skilled investigators has never been greater. Digital forensics provides the capabilities to analyze hidden data from computers, shedding light on crimes that may otherwise remain ambiguous. From tracking down cybercriminals to investigating past events, digital forensics empowers law enforcement, corporations, and people alike to obtain justice and insight.
The methodology involves a meticulous examination of hard drives, communication logs, and other digital artifacts. Through specialized software and analytical methods, investigators can recover deleted files, trace user activity, and establish connections that may be essential in determining the truth.
Concurrently, digital forensics acts as a link between the intangible world of bits and bytes and the tangible world of human actions and consequences. It provides a essential means to understand the digital footprint we all leave behind, helping us to navigate the complexities of a connected society.
